Improved sidebar resizing

This commit is contained in:
Geomitron
2020-05-30 00:16:59 -04:00
parent fe6d8d2545
commit f7bc59ab5f
2 changed files with 12 additions and 3 deletions

View File

@@ -19,8 +19,8 @@
</div>
</div>
<div class="ui positive buttons">
<div class="ui button" (click)="onDownloadClicked()">{{downloadButtonText}}</div>
<div id="downloadButtons" class="ui positive buttons">
<div id="downloadButton" class="ui button" (click)="onDownloadClicked()">{{downloadButtonText}}</div>
<div *ngIf="getSelectedChartVersions().length > 1" id="versionDropdown" class="ui floating dropdown icon button">
<i class="dropdown icon"></i>
</div>

View File

@@ -9,19 +9,28 @@
#textPanel {
flex-grow: 1;
overflow-y: auto;
}
#versionDropdown {
max-width: min-content;
}
#chartDropdown {
min-height: min-content;
}
::ng-deep #chartDropdownMenu > div.item {
white-space: normal;
word-break: break-word;
}
#chartDropdownIcon {
#chartDropdownIcon, #versionDropdown {
display: flex;
flex-direction: column;
justify-content: center;
}
#downloadButton {
width: min-content;
}